Overview

The Virgin Islands Continuum of Care on Homelessness, Inc. seeks qualified individuals or firms to provide accounting and payroll services supporting financial management, grant compliance, and reporting in accordance with HUD requirements, 2 CFR Part 200 (Uniform Guidance), and GAAP.

Scope of Services

  • Maintaining the general ledger and chart of accounts
  • Managing accounts payable and receivable
  • Managing payroll
  • Performing monthly bank reconciliations
  • Preparing monthly, quarterly, and annual financial reports
  • Monitoring grant expenditures and ensuring HUD CoC and ESG compliance
  • Assisting with budget preparation and financial forecasting
  • Ensuring compliance with 2 CFR Part 200
  • Assisting with annual audits
  • Providing financial guidance to leadership and program staff

Minimum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or related field
  • Minimum of 3 years of relevant accounting experience
  • Experience with nonprofit and/or federally funded programs
  • Familiarity with 2 CFR Part 200 (Uniform Guidance)
  • Proficiency in accounting software (QuickBooks or equivalent)
